Right Away, Great Captain! to Re-release Vinyl Box Set in 2015

Die hard Manchester Orchestra fans get some good news today. The band’s frontman, Andy Hull, announced his solo project Right Away, Great Captain! will be re-releasing its four full-length LPs on vinyl for a brand new box set in 2015. Derek Archambault (Defeater) Announces “Alcoa” Solo Project

Defeater vocalist Derek Archambault has announced his brand new solo project, called Alcoa, and the debut release will come late in 2012. Jon Walker’s solo project

Jon Walker, ex-bassist of Panic! At The Disco and guitarist of The Young Veins, has released a solo project. The album is called Home Recordings and has a similar sound as The Young Veins and The Beatles. You can purchase the cd here.
